What is Anji Foodstuff Co PEG Ratio?

PE Ratio without NRI / 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ate*

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use is the 5-Year EBITDA growth rate. As of today, Anji Foodstuff Co's PE Ratio without NRI is 93.94. Anji Foodstuff Co's 5-Year EBITDA growth rate is -3.10%. Therefore, Anji Foodstuff Co's PEG Ratio for today is N/A.

* The 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ate is the 5-year average EBITDA per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

Anji Foodstuff Co  (SHSE:603696)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Anji Foodstuff Co Business Description

Address 4-9A, Qingmeng Science and Technology Industrial Zone, Fujian Province, Quanzhou, CHN, 362005
Anji Foodstuff Co Ltd is engaged in the research and development, production and sales of seasoning. The company has five products namely seasoning powder of mixed flavors, seasoning from natural extracts, herbs and spices, sauce and condensed soup. Its seasoning powder of mixed flavors includes seasoning for spare-rib, concentrated pork stock, beef powder, and other. Its seasonings from natural extracts comprise mushroom extract seasoning, bonito flavor bisque, scallop bisque, and others. The company herbs and spices comprise white pepper powder, five spices powder, and others; sauces include oyster, chili, curry seasoning, spare rib, and other sauces.
